On Mon, Jun 18, 2012 at 6:44 PM, Dmitry Antipov <dmantipov@yandex.ru> wrote:
> but it seems that this tool opens a lot of other opportunities. For example,
> attached patch was
> generated with the very simple "semantic patch":
>
> @expression@
> identifier I1, I2;
> expression E1, E2;
> @@
> (
> - XVECTOR (I1)->contents[I2++] = E1
> + ASET (I1, I2, E1), I2++
> |
> - XVECTOR (I1)->contents[E1] = E2
> + ASET (I1, E1, E2)
> |
> -XVECTOR (I1)->contents[E1]
> +AREF (I1, E1)
> )
>
> and following minimal manual intervention, so I suspect that more useful
> cleanups may be done
> with this tool.
